U.S. v. DeMartino, No. 96-1725 (2nd Cir.) (112 F.3d 75) (April 23, 1997) (Judge Amalya Lyle Kearse)

Case held that oral sentence normally prevails over subsequent written sentence unless the oral sentence that was pronounced was illegal.
